Hi, 

 

Im relatively new to DVBViewer though am able to set it up and access live tv ( UK Freeview) though after switching off my computer after an install the screen goes black. The signal strength appears to be 90% and the tv program information appears up to date though there is no picture. I have tried modifying the video renderer options in the direct X settings (in Video B) though this hasn't helped.

 

Any help would be appreciated, ive looked around online though a lot of the responses are 15 or so years old and havent helped too much.

Which DVB device?

 

Some older DVB device drivers can't cope with the Windows 10 fast boot (AKA fast startup) feature, which doesn't really shut the PC down when you switch it off, but puts it to a kind of hibernate mode. In this case rebooting the PC (not switching it off and restarting it!) will make it work again. If this is true, you will need to switch the fast boot feature off.
